About VoiceToNotes
VoiceToNotes.ai is an intelligent, voice-first workspace designed to bridge the gap between productivity and leisure. By combining AI-driven note-taking with an integrated library of 100+ novels, it allows users to effortlessly capture ideas, structure knowledge, and dive into stories across all their devices.

Problem Statement
Problem Solution
VoiceToNotes.ai offers a powerful AI transcription experience, but first-time visitors had only a few seconds to understand what the product does and why they should trust it. Without a clear value proposition and a guided experience, users could leave before discovering the product's true potential.
I designed a conversion-focused landing page that communicates the product's value immediately, reinforces trust through thoughtful branding and visual hierarchy, and guides users naturally toward taking action without overwhelming them.

User Insights
What our users need, think & care about
We interviewed potential users, studied reviews, and analyzed competitors to uncover what matters most. These insights directly shaped the structure, content and experience of the VoiceNotes.ai landing page.
Pain Points
Unclear value in seconds
Many AI tools fail to communicate what they do clearly. Users leave before understanding the value.
Trust & accuracy concerns
Features worry about accuracy, data safety, and reliability before trying any AI tool.
Too much information
Feature-heavy landing pages overwhelm users, competing content makes decision-making harder.
No clear next step
Unclear or weak CTAs fail to create momentum and reduce the chances of sign-up.
Want to see it in action
Users prefer real examples or previews over text to understand how the product works.
Key Takeaway
"I just want to know quickly what it does, if I can trust it, and how it will help me — then I'm ready to try it."
— Interview Participant
Key Insights
01
Clarity drives engagement
Users want to instantly understand what the product does and how it helps them — before they commit any time to exploring it.
02
Trust builds confidence
Trust triggers healthy skepticism. Users look for signals of accuracy, data safety, and social proof before trying any AI product.
03
Seeing is believing
Abstract claims fall flat. Included an interactive demo or real examples to show the product in action.
04
Simple path to get started
A clear and prominent call-to-action removes friction and substantially boosts conversions when paired with low commitment messaging.

01
User-Centric Planning
Every section is designed around user intent and the questions they arrive with.
02
Progressive Disclosure
Information is revealed in layers — overview first, depth on demand.
03
Trust First
Social proof and credibility signals appear early to reduce friction.
04
Action-Oriented
Clear CTAs are placed at every natural decision point in the journey.
What Really Happened
Looking back, the biggest takeaway wasn't the final UI—it was everything that happened before it. Research uncovered new insights, feedback challenged my assumptions, requirements evolved, and some ideas simply didn't work as expected. By staying open to iteration instead of chasing a perfect first solution, I was able to create a stronger, more thoughtful experience that balanced user needs with business and technical goals.

The Final Product


Footer
I wanted the footer to feel useful rather than overlooked. In addition to providing access to important pages, I included a simple subscription section for users who may not be ready to sign up but still want to follow the product's journey and receive future updates.
Feature Section
My goal was to make the feature section feel like a guided product tour rather than a static list of capabilities. Each scroll introduces a new mobile screen and explains its purpose, allowing users to explore the platform progressively while maintaining focus on one feature at a time.
Although the animation isn't visible in this case study, it plays an important role in pacing the experience and making the product easier to understand.


Creating a Unified Experience
I wanted this section to feel like the product coming together. Instead of focusing on a single device, I showcased the entire ecosystem to communicate that VoiceToNotes is designed to fit naturally into a user's everyday workflow. Whether they're using a desktop, mobile phone, or smartwatch, the experience remains connected and consistent.



Desktop Experience
After introducing the product through the mobile experience, I wanted to reassure users that VoiceToNotes isn't limited to a phone.
Showcasing the desktop workspace early helps establish it as a complete cross-platform product, allowing users to immediately understand that they can simply log in and continue their work from any device.
Hero Section
The hero section was designed to introduce VoiceToNotes' two core experiences—Editor and Novels—from the very first interaction. Instead of relying on a single static mockup, a split animation reveals both interfaces simultaneously, creating a memorable first impression while helping users immediately understand the platform's versatility.
Concept
The navigation prioritizes Log In and Get Mobile App, giving returning users quick access while encouraging new visitors to download the app. Contextual call-to-action buttons placed alongside each mockup guide users toward the experience most relevant to them, making the hero both engaging and conversion-focused.
